Transaction 65bee30323e6bec1d5a33c79cd27c09326259c62056759f68dbae3e150e82d65
1 Input
1 Output
-
65bee30323e6bec1d5a33c79cd27c09326259c62056759f68dbae3e150e82d65:0
- value
- 1693487
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e74575258ec4023e8431924c35f4501a7fff5b8
- address
- bc1q3e69w5jca3qz86zrryjvxh69qxnlladchk0y4j